Clear: Recently I ran out of shampoo and conditioner. I was using Aussie's volume shampoo and conditioner and I seriously loved it and almost bought it again but next to it was that new brand Clear and I've read and heard from a few people that they really liked this brand. I picked up the Volumizing shampoo and conditioner. So far I'm loving it! I have super fine, thin hair. I have to wash it every day and I can't use heavy products or it makes my hair really greasy really fast and/or weighed down. The first time I used Clear I was a little scared because, while applying, it is REALLY creamy and felt a little heavy. To my surprise my hair has volume, it's soft and shiny, and it doesn't feel greasy or weighed down! I'm excited to keep using this to see if I get any build up or if it's still going to keep making my hair feel awesome!
